  • Comments Thread For: Eddie Hearn: 'No Reason' Joshua-Miller Shouldn't Happen in U.S.

    Eddie Hearn considers Jarrell Miller a perfect opponent for Anthony Joshua to face once Joshua decides to fight in the United States. Hearn said during a conference call Thursday night that there's "no reason" a bout between Joshua (19-0, 19 KOs), the IBF/IBO/WBA heavyweight champion promoted by Hearn's company, and Miller shouldn't take place. There has been plenty of talk from both sides this week about an eventual Joshua-Deontay Wilder title unification showdown, but Hearn sounded just as open Thursday to Joshua meeting Miller in a heavyweight title fight.
